What Tools Can Help with Weather Planning?
Having the right tools makes all the difference when planning ahead for your trips. Weather apps can provide important information such as radar visualizations, temperature forecasts, and alerts about severe weather conditions. Utilizing a dedicated weather app like Clime enables travelers to see real-time data, helping them make informed decisions about their journeys.
How to Use Clime for Efficient Weather Planning
Clime stands out with its radar-first approach, offering features that are particularly useful for travelers. With Clime, you can:
- Track Hurricanes and Storms: Access to dedicated hurricane tracking and lightning visualizations allows you to maintain awareness of severe weather events.
- Get 14-Day Forecasts: The app provides a detailed 14-day forecast including temperature, precipitation, and UV index, enabling you to plan your activities more efficiently.
- Receive Alerts: Set up notifications for severe weather alerts to keep you and your travel companions safe.
Limitations of Clime
While Clime is an exceptional tool for weather monitoring, it should be noted that it does not include flight tracking capabilities. This means that while you can see how weather may impact your travel routes, you would need to pair it with another service for live flight status updates.
